How this is computed
The classic E6B wind side: given course, TAS, and the wind, find the heading to crab and the groundspeed that results. Standard vector decomposition (heading and course share one reference — both true or both magnetic); pinned by scripts/test-tools-core.ts. A 25 kt wind 50° off the nose of a 120 kt airplane costs about 18 kt of groundspeed and 9° of crab.
